内容正文:
文字识别
一、教学目标
1. 让学生了解文字识别的基本概念和应用场景。
2. 让学生通过实际操作体验文字识别的过程。
3. 让学生掌握文字识别技术的基本原理。
4. 培养学生的信息素养和动手实践能力。
5. 激发学生对信息技术领域的兴趣和探索欲望。
二、教学重点与难点
教学重点
文字识别的基本概念及其在现代生活中的应用。
文字识别的基本原理和过程。
教学难点
理解文字识别技术的内部工作机制。
如何在实际操作中准确地进行文字识别。
三、教学准备
准备文字识别的相关软件或应用。
收集不同字体、大小、清晰度的文字图片作为识别对象。
准备多媒体演示设备,用于展示文字识别的过程和结果。
四、教学过程
(一)导入新课
通过展示一些包含文字的图片,如路标、广告牌等,引发学生的好奇心。
提问学生:如何在没有人工输入的情况下,让计算机识别并理解这些文字信息呢?
引出本节课的主题——文字识别。
(二)新课讲解
1.文字识别的基本概念
文字识别(OCR,OpticalCharacterRecognition)是一种从扫描文档、图像或照片中提取文本信息的技术。它能够将图像中的文字转换成可编辑和可检索的文本格式,从而方便人们进行数据处理和信息检索。
2.文字识别的应用场景
(1)文档数字化:将纸质文档扫描成电子文档,便于存储、检索和编辑。
(2)车牌识别:自动识别车牌号码,用于交通管理、停车收费等场景。
(3)银行支票处理:自动识别支票上的信息,提高处理效率。
(4)图像内文本提取:从包含文字的图片中提取出文本信息。
3.文字识别的基本原理
(1)预处理:对输入的图像进行去噪、二值化、分割等操作,以提高识别的准确性。
(2)特征提取:从预处理后的图像中提取出字符的特征,如线条、角点、网格等。
(3)字符识别:将提取出的特征与预先训练的字符模型进行匹配,从而识别出对应的字符。
(4)后处理:对识别结果进行校正和优化,提高识别的准确率。
4.文字识别的技术挑战
(1)字体多样性:不同字体、大小、方向的文字识别难度不同。
(2)图像质量:模糊、扭曲、噪声等都会影响识别的准确性。
(3)背景干扰:复杂的背景图案或颜色可能会对识别造成干扰。
5.文字识别技术的发展趋势
随着深度学习技术的发展,文字识别的准确率和速度都得到了显著提升。未来,文字识别技术将更加智能化、高效化和多样化,为人们的生活带来更多便利。
(三)巩固练习
为了让学生更好地理解和掌握文字识别技术,我们设计了一系列实践活动。
1.动手实践:体验文字识别
(1)教师提供一款文字识别软件或应用,并演示其基本操作方法。
(2)学生自己动手操作,将收集到的文字图片进行识别,观察并记录识别结果。
(3)小组讨论:比较各组的识别结果,分析影响识别准确性的因素。
2.案例分析:文字识别的应用实例
(1)教师展示几个文字识别的应用实例,如银行支票处理系统、车牌识别系统等。
(2)学生分组讨论:这些应用实例中文字识别技术的作用和价值,以及可能面临的挑战。
(3)小组汇报:每组选派一名代表汇报讨论结果,其他组进行点评和补充。
3.编程挑战:简单文字识别程序
(针对有编程基础的学生)
(1)教师提供一段简单的文字识别程序代码,并解释其工作原理。
(2)学生尝试修改程序参数或添加新功能,以提高文字识别的准确性和效率。
(3)成果展示:学生展示自己的编程成果,并分享改进经验和心得。
通过这些实践活动,学生不仅能够加深对文字识别技术的理解,还能在实际操作中提升自己的动手实践能力和创新思维。同时,小组合作与讨论也有助于培养学生的团队协作精神和沟通能力。
(四)课堂小结
回顾本节课所学内容,总结文字识别的基本概念、应用场景和基本原理。
强调文字识别在现代生活中的重要性和应用价值。
鼓励学生继续关注和学习信息技术领域的新知识、新技术。
(五)作业布置
让学生在家中寻找包含文字的图片,尝试使用文字识别软件进行识别,并记录识别结果和准确率。
让学生思考并讨论:如果你是文字识别技术的开发者,你会如何改进现有的技术以提高识别的准确性和效率?请提出具体的方案或建议。
五、板书设计
《文字识别》
文字识别(OCR)
基本概念
应用场景:文档数字化、车牌识别等
基本原理:预处理、特征提取、字符识别、后处理
技术挑战与发展趋势
六、课后反思
本节课通过生动的导入和详细的新课讲解,成功地引发了学生对文字识别技术的兴趣。在实践活动中,学生积极参与,动手操作能力得到了锻炼。特别是在编程挑战环节,部分有编程基础的学生展现出了较高的创新思维和实践能力。然而,也有一些学生在文字识别软件的操作上遇到了困难,提示我在今后的教学中需要更加注重软件操作的指导。此外,对于没有编程基础的学生,如何设计更合适的实践活动以提升他们的参与度也是一个值得思考的问题。总体而言,